| 80705 | 2002-09-18 11:23:00 | Yes it is possible to convert a DVD player to multizone. How it is done depends on what brand and model. Next Electronics is one local company that I have seen advertising that they can "chip" a DVD player for multizone. But do some research on the net first. All you may have to do with your DVD player is enter a service mode and change a setting. Also be aware that "chipping" your player will void any warrenty.
